  • When I tell my watch I'm swimmng at a pool it lists the length of the lanes. The pool has movable bulkheads so it's usually set up with 25m lanes but sometimes it's 50m. If I forget to reset the distance from 25 to 50, it still counts the lengths but thinks I'm reeeally slow and taking lots of strokes. :smiley:

  • When the watch records a workout for me, I usually first check that the workout is showing in the iPhone's Fitness app. Then when I open the MFP app, the workout shows there. I still use the sync function under "More" in the MFP app to make it show up on the MFP website right away.
